随着互联网的快速发展,网络服务器的配置与管理显得尤为重要。在这个数字化时代,几乎所有的企业、组织和个人都需要依赖网络服务器来存储、传输和管理数据。了解和掌握网络服务器的配置与管理技巧,对于提高数据安全性、保障数据的稳定性以及提升用户体验都具有重要意义。

1.搭建服务器:了解服务器硬件需求和选择合适的操作系统及软件

-搭建一个可靠、高效的服务器需要根据实际需求来选择合适的硬件配置,如处理器、内存、存储空间等,并在此基础上选择适合的操作系统和服务器软件。

2.网络配置:优化服务器网络环境,确保稳定的数据传输

-通过合理设置网络参数和优化网络拓扑结构,确保服务器与客户端之间的数据传输更加稳定和高效。

3.安全防护:保障服务器数据安全,防止非法入侵和数据泄露

-通过配置防火墙、安装安全补丁、设置访问控制和加密等手段,加强服务器的安全防护,防止非法入侵和数据泄露。

4.资源管理:合理规划和管理服务器资源,提升性能和可靠性

-通过合理的资源规划和管理,如分配带宽、磁盘空间、内存等,确保服务器的性能和可靠性。

5.监控与维护:实时监控服务器状态,及时处理故障和问题

-通过监控服务器的运行状态、日志记录和警报系统,及时发现和解决故障,并进行定期的维护工作,确保服务器的持续稳定运行。

6.负载均衡:提高服务器处理能力,分担压力

-通过配置负载均衡器,将流量均衡分配到不同的服务器上,提高整体处理能力和可扩展性。

7.数据备份与恢复:确保数据安全和可靠性

-建立合理的数据备份策略,并定期进行数据备份,以确保在意外情况下能够及时恢复数据。

8.远程管理:灵活管理服务器,提高工作效率

-通过远程管理工具,可以方便地对服务器进行配置、监控和维护,提高工作效率和响应速度。

9.容器化技术:提升服务器资源的利用效率和灵活性

-通过使用容器化技术,将应用程序与其依赖的库和环境隔离开来,提高资源的利用效率和服务器的灵活性。

10.性能优化:通过调优和优化服务器配置,提升性能

-通过调整服务器的参数、优化代码和使用缓存等手段,提升服务器的性能和响应速度。

11.虚拟化技术:提高服务器资源的利用率和弹性

-通过虚拟化技术,将物理服务器划分为多个虚拟机,提高服务器资源的利用率和弹性。

12.日志管理:有效记录和分析服务器日志,快速定位问题

-通过有效地记录和分析服务器的日志,可以快速定位问题,并进行相应的处理。

13.自动化运维:通过自动化工具简化运维流程,提高效率

-通过使用自动化运维工具,可以简化运维流程,提高工作效率和减少人为错误。

14.灾备与容灾:保障服务器的高可用性和数据的持续性

-通过配置灾备方案和容灾策略,确保服务器的高可用性和数据的持续性。

15.管理策略与规范:建立合理的管理策略和规范,提升管理效能

-建立合理的管理策略和规范,如权限管理、变更管理和文档管理等,提升服务器的管理效能。

网络服务器配置与管理是保障数据安全、提升性能和可靠性的关键环节。通过了解和掌握服务器配置与管理的技巧,可以为企业、组织和个人提供更加稳定和高效的网络服务。无论是初级还是高级的网络管理员,都应该重视并深入研究网络服务器配置与管理的方法和技术。